The Illinois Heartland Library System (IHLS), the Illinois Library Association (ILA), and the Reaching Across Illinois Library System (RAILS) have launched DU on Demand, a new professional development initiative for library personnel across the state.
Announced on September 11, 2025, the program provides online content from Directors University on Demand. The resource is specifically designed to support new public library directors in their professional growth and leadership development.
While the curriculum is tailored for those entering directorial roles, the organizations stated that the content is available to staff members of any level at any library within Illinois.
The materials are shared at no cost to the participating libraries and their employees, aiming to make professional learning and leadership training more accessible to the state’s library workforce.
